Tactical Grade FOG Sensor Fiber Optic Gyroscope with 0.03 ARW for Wind Turbine Monitoring

The MFOG-24 Micro-Nano Fiber Optic Gyroscope is a compact, high-performance angular rate sensor designed for advanced attitude control and motion measurement systems. Based on the Sagnac effect, this fiber optic gyroscope integrates optical, mechanical, and electronic components into a lightweight cylindrical package (Φ24×39mm).

Key Advantages
  • No moving parts or wear components for maximum reliability
  • Fast startup capability for immediate operation
  • Excellent zero-bias stability (≤1.5°/h)
  • Low angular random walk (≤0.03°/√h)
  • High bandwidth up to 450Hz
  • Compact size and lightweight design (≤30g)

The MFOG-24's compact dimensions and robust performance make it ideal for UAVs, unmanned vehicles, robotics, stabilization platforms, precision navigation systems, and wind turbine monitoring applications.

Technical Specifications
Environmental & Power Specifications
  • Operating temperature: -40°C to +65°C
  • Power consumption: ≤1.5W
  • Vibration resistance: 20g (20-2000Hz)
  • Dimensions: φ24×39mm
Performance Specifications
Parameter MFOG-24 MFOG-24-AN
Range (°/s) ±500 ±300
Scale factor 3600 (LSB/o/s) 7mv/o/s
Scale factor nonlinearity (ppm) 300 ≤1000
Zero-bias stability (10s, 1σ, °/h) ≤1.5 ≤2
Zero-bias repeatability (1σ, °/h) ≤1.5 ≤2
Angular random walk (°/h1/2) ≤0.03 ≤0.04
Zero bias (°/s) ≤0.02 ≤0.05
3dB Band Width (Hz) ≥300 ≥450
Power supply (V) 5+0.15 5+0.15
Power Consumption (W) ≤1.5 ≤0.7
